
.cartes{
position: absolute;
left: 50%;
margin-left: -355px;
top: 50%;
margin-top: -223px;
width: 700px;
height: 450px;
z-index: 11;
background-color: #868079;
visibility: visible;
}

.menus_cartes{
position: absolute;
left: 20px;
top: 280px;
width: 180px;
height: 150px;
border-style: solid;
border-color: gray;
border-width: 1px;
background-image:url("images/home/fd_menu_cartes.jpg");
z-index: 1;
}
.lay_menus{
position: absolute;
left: 272px;
top: 20px;
width: 401px;
height: 420px;
z-index: 2;
background-color: #CCCCCC;
visibility: hidden;
}
.closmenu{
position: absolute;
left: 383px;
top:-6px;
width: 15px;
height: 15px;
padding: 4;
z-index: 12;
visibility: inherit;
}
.closcart{
position: absolute;
left: 650px;
top: -25px;
width: 50px;
height: 12px;
z-index: 100;
background-color:white;
text-align:center;
line-height:100%;
visibility:inherit;
border-style:dotted;
border-width:2;
border-color:gray;
}
.afdcartes{
position: absolute;
left: 50%;
margin-left: -355px;
top: 50%;
margin-top: -238px;
width: 715px;
height: 465px;
z-index: 9;
background-image: url("images/fd_site.gif");
visibility: visible;
}
.afdcartes2{
position: absolute;
left: 0px;
top: 0px;
width: 700px;
height: 455px;
z-index: 1;
background-image: url("images/fd_cartes.jpg");
visibility: visible;
}
.lay_bas_menu{
position: absolute;
left: 0px;
top: 400px;
width: 401px;
z-index: 2;
}

.lay_infos{
position: absolute;
left: 50%;
margin-left: -375px;
top:50%;
margin-top: -310px;
width: 350px;
height: 530px;
z-index: 5;
visibility: hidden;
}
.infoshad{
position: absolute;
left: 50%;
margin-left: -386px;
top:50%;
margin-top: -281px;
width: 380px;
height: 530px;
background-image: url("images/home/fd_info.gif");
z-index: 4;
visibility: hidden;
}
.infofd{
position: absolute;
left: 45px;
top: 40px;
width: 255px;
height: 420px;
background-image: url("images/home/fd_info70.jpg");
border-style: solid;
border-color: gray;
border-width: 1px;
z-index: 0;
visibility: inherit;
}
.cinfo{
position: absolute;
left: 290px;
top:32px;
width: 17px;
height: 16px;
z-index: 7;
border:none;
padding:2;
background-color: white;
visibility: inherit;
}
.info1{
position: absolute;
left: 0px;
top:10px;
width: 375px;
height: 150px;
z-index: 3;
visibility: inherit;
}
.info2{
position: absolute;
left: 65px;
top:155px;
width: 310px;
height: 70px;
z-index: 3;
visibility: inherit;
}
.info3{
position: absolute;
left: 65px;
top:230px;
width: 310px;
height: 70px;
z-index: 3;
visibility: inherit;
}
.info4{
position: absolute;
left: 65px;
top:300px;
width: 310px;
height: 70px;
z-index: 3;
visibility: inherit;
}
.info5{
position: absolute;
left: 65px;
top:370px;
width: 310px;
height: 70px;
border-style: solid;
border-color: gray;
border-width: 1px;
z-index: 3;
visibility: inherit;
}
.info6{
position: absolute;
left: 60px;
top: 430px;
width: 310px;
height: 10px;
z-index: 1;
visibility: inherit;
}

.panorama{
position: absolute;
left: 50%;
margin-left: -350px;
top:50%;
margin-top: -160px;
width: 698px;
height: 405px;
z-index: 10;
visibility: hidden;
}

.recette{
position: absolute;
left: 50%;
margin-left: -381px;
top:50%;
margin-top: -265px;
width: 400px;
height: 500px;
z-index: 5;
background-color: #868079;
background-image: url("images/home/rec_fd.gif");
border-style: solid;
border-color: gray;
border-width: 1px;
visibility: visible;
}
.recswf{
position: absolute;
left: 0px;
margin-left: 0px;
top: 0px;
margin-top: 150px;
width: 400px;
height: 450px;
z-index: 6;
visibility: visible;
}
.recshad{
position: absolute;
left: 50%;
margin-left: -381px;
top:50%;
margin-top: -282px;
width: 420px;
height: 520px;
z-index: 4;
background-image: url("images/home/rec_shadow.gif");
visibility: visible;
}

.cavehtm{
position: absolute;
left: 50%;
margin-left: -439px;
top: 20px;
margin-top: 0px;
width: 520px;
height: 96%;
overflow: auto;
background-color: white;
background-image: url("images/home/cav_fd.gif");
border-style: solid;
border-color: gray;
border-width: 1px;
z-index: 10;
}
.closcave{
position: absolute;
left: 484px;
top: 2px;
width: 13px;
height: 12px;
z-index: 11;
visibility: visible;
}

.l0t0 {
position: absolute;
width: 10px;
left: 0px;
margin-left:0px;
top: 0px;
margin-top:0px;
height: 10px;
background-color: transparent;
border-style:solid;
border-width:0;
border-color:gray;
}

.l50t0 {
position: absolute;
width: 800px;
left: 50%;
margin-left:-400px;
top: 0px;
margin-top:0px;
height: 10px;
background-color: transparent;
border-style:solid;
border-width:0;
border-color:gray;
}

